#2fb345 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2fb345 is composed of 18.4% red, 70.2% green and 27.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 61.5%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 130 degrees, a saturation of 58.4% and a lightness of 44.3%. #2fb345 color hex could be obtained by blending #5eff8a with #006700.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

#2fb345 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2fb345 has RGB values of R:47, G:179, B:69 and CMYK values of C:0.74, M:0, Y:0.61,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 3126085.

Shades and Tints of #2fb345
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020803 is the darkest color, while #f8fdf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2fb345
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c766e is the less saturated color, while #04de28 is the most saturated one.
